Meet Dolly

Dolly is a gentle lady who thoroughly enjoys human attention and a bit of pampering. She is a good girl to handle and always does what is asked of her. In the herd she likes to stay close to one or two special friends rather than be in the middle of the general hustle and bustle. She can pull the odd face to a herd member she thinks may pose a threat but will then walk off to avoid any conflict. Dolly much prefers a quiet life with like minded friends. Dolly is prone to putting on weight easily so this must be carefully monitored. Dolly will suit a quiet home with a regular routine where she can relax and enjoy her golden years.

Important stuff

This horse is based at Hall Farm, where we’ve been managing a strangles outbreak in some of our horses. They have been screened using guttural pouch lavage (the gold standard test), completed a full course of strangles vaccinations, and spent time in quarantine in a green zone paddock. They are now available for rehoming as part of our phased return to normal activities.

Dolly can never be ridden or driven.

All equines in our centres are regularly assessed by a team of experts including a vet, physiotherapist and farrier, and these assessments have found that Dolly is not suitable to be worked.
